Udostępnij za pośrednictwem


DbRawSqlQuery<TElement>.ToListAsync Metoda

Definicja

Przeciążenia

ToListAsync()

Tworzy element List<T> na podstawie zapytania, wyliczając go asynchronicznie.

ToListAsync(CancellationToken)

Tworzy element List<T> na podstawie zapytania, wyliczając go asynchronicznie.

ToListAsync()

Tworzy element List<T> na podstawie zapytania, wyliczając go asynchronicznie.

[System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Design", "CA1006:DoNotNestGenericTypesInMemberSignatures")]
public System.Threading.Tasks.Task<System.Collections.Generic.List<TElement>> ToListAsync ();
member this.ToListAsync : unit -> System.Threading.Tasks.Task<System.Collections.Generic.List<'Element>>
Public Function ToListAsync () As Task(Of List(Of TElement))

Zwraca

Task<List<TElement>>

Zadanie reprezentujące operację asynchroniczną. Wynik zadania zawiera element List<T> zawierający elementy z sekwencji wejściowej.

Atrybuty

Uwagi

Wiele aktywnych operacji na tym samym wystąpieniu kontekstu nie jest obsługiwanych. Użyj polecenia "await", aby upewnić się, że wszystkie operacje asynchroniczne zostały ukończone przed wywołaniem innej metody w tym kontekście.

Dotyczy

ToListAsync(CancellationToken)

Tworzy element List<T> na podstawie zapytania, wyliczając go asynchronicznie.

[System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Design", "CA1006:DoNotNestGenericTypesInMemberSignatures")]
public System.Threading.Tasks.Task<System.Collections.Generic.List<TElement>> ToListAsync (System.Threading.CancellationToken cancellationToken);
member this.ToListAsync : System.Threading.CancellationToken -> System.Threading.Tasks.Task<System.Collections.Generic.List<'Element>>

Parametry

cancellationToken
CancellationToken

Element CancellationToken do obserwowania podczas oczekiwania na ukończenie zadania.

Zwraca

Task<List<TElement>>

Zadanie reprezentujące operację asynchroniczną. Wynik zadania zawiera element List<T> zawierający elementy z sekwencji wejściowej.

Atrybuty

Uwagi

Wiele aktywnych operacji na tym samym wystąpieniu kontekstu nie jest obsługiwanych. Użyj polecenia "await", aby upewnić się, że wszystkie operacje asynchroniczne zostały ukończone przed wywołaniem innej metody w tym kontekście.

Dotyczy